Tick the ‘mile high club’ off your bucket list

• Student Flights launches new service that will enable travellers to ‘hook up’ mid-air and join the elusive ‘mile-high club’
• First of its kind for travel retailers
• Check in & start checking out…people on your flight
Dimming the cabin lights now turns you on – Student Flights today launched a new service to help customers ‘hook up’ with other passengers hoping to have a bit of fun ‘mid-air’.

The new offering is a first of its kind for travel retailers and will provide travellers with a unique way of ‘hooking-up’ with other likeminded individuals.

Airports & plane rides have never been so exciting! Student Flights NZ Brand Leader, Sean Berenson said, “travel has always been exciting, especially the lead up. Previously it was the anticipation of the new things you’ll see & experience when you get to your destination, but now you can experience new things on the flight as well.”

Student Flights listened to their customers before introducing the new service, wanting to really understand what would make the travel experience even more thrilling and adventurous.

“We’re all about encouraging travellers to get out there and have new experiences, visit news places and make lifetime friends and we found our customers were looking for new and exciting ways to do this and so we developed this new service to enable them to interact,” Mr Berenson said.

Make sure you’re WiFi is on so you can ‘get connected’ – to ‘hook-up’ with other passengers customers simply download the new ‘mile-high club’ app, available on android and iphone. The easy to use app allows travellers to ‘match’ with other passengers on their flight whereby users log on and register their interest, if there are other passengers on the flight looking to ‘hook up’ and ‘join the mile high club’ the option will be given to connect. The service is also available on the brands website and customers can register their interest with their travel expert when booking in store.

Don’t miss out on a bit of ‘flight foreplay’ – as well as matching with travellers on their flights the service also offers additional perks such as ‘hook up seat selection’. This service allows Student Flight travel experts to seat match passengers next to each other on flights, when there is availability. This means ‘hooking up’ can start at take off.

“For single passengers especially this is going to make travelling solo a lot more fun – no more worrying about being bored for the next 12 hours, its revolutionary,” Mr Berenson said.

Student Flights customers are encouraged to register their interest in the new service on the brand’s website.
